February 01, 2002   February 01, 2002 The GP2015 is a small format RF Front-end for Global Positioning System (GPS) receivers. Equivalent in performance to the GP2010 but in a TQFP package, this product is suited for size-critical applications as the RF area can be reduced by a factor of two to three using miniature surface mount passive components.

February 01, 2002   February 01, 2002 The MT90222/3/4 family, are multi-rate inverse multiplexing for ATM (IMA) and transmission convergence (TC) devices that process ATM traffic for transmission over T1/E1, fractional T1/E1 and DSL lines. The MT90222/3/4 integrates features that optimize flexibility and easy implementation of broadband access equipment. Mixed-mode services allow for concurrent IMA and TC layer applications.

January 01, 2002   January 01, 2002 The GP4020 GPS Baseband Processor combines the flexibility of the GP2021 12-channel correlator with the power of an ARM7TDMI microprocessor in a single device. The GP4020 operates with the existing GP2015 GPS RF Front End device to produce a new 3.3 V GPS Receiver architecture for Navstar L1 C/A-code GPS.
